微信资源服务器如何搭建

worktile 其他 51

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要搭建微信资源服务器,需要遵循以下步骤:

    步骤1:准备服务器
    首先,你需要获得一台云服务器。你可以选择自己购买服务器,也可以使用一些云计算服务商提供的服务。确保服务器具有稳定的网络连接和足够的存储空间。

    步骤2:安装操作系统
    根据你的需求,选择合适的操作系统进行安装。常见的操作系统有Linux,Windows Server等。对于搭建微信资源服务器,Linux系统是一个较好的选择,比如Ubuntu、CentOS等。

    步骤3:安装所需软件
    微信资源服务器依赖于一些软件来实现功能,主要有Nginx、Redis和FastDFS。

    首先,安装Nginx。Nginx是一款高性能的Web服务器,可以用来处理网页的静态资源。可以通过在终端执行命令进行安装。

    安装Redis。Redis是一款高性能的键值存储系统,可以用来缓存微信的临时资源。同样,可以通过终端命令来进行安装。

    然后,安装FastDFS。FastDFS是一个开源的分布式文件系统,可以用来存储微信的多媒体资源。你可以从官方网站下载并安装FastDFS。

    步骤4:配置Nginx
    在安装并成功运行Nginx后,你需要配置它来代理请求到FastDFS和处理静态资源。编辑Nginx的配置文件,配置反向代理和静态资源的路径。通过重启Nginx服务使配置生效。

    步骤5:配置FastDFS
    在安装并成功运行FastDFS后,你需要进行一些配置来确保它能正常工作。主要包括配置tracker服务器和storage服务器。配置文件是storage.conf和tracker.conf文件,你需要根据自己的需求进行相应的配置。

    步骤6:启动服务
    完成以上配置后,你可以启动Nginx、Redis和FastDFS的服务。确保这三个服务都能正常运行。

    步骤7:测试服务器
    最后,你可以使用微信公众号开发者工具或其他HTTP工具来测试服务器的功能。你可以上传一个测试用的媒体文件,并通过分享链接或其他方式验证资源服务器的搭建情况。

    总结:
    搭建微信资源服务器需要准备服务器、安装操作系统、安装必要的软件、配置Nginx和FastDFS,并最终启动服务和进行测试。正确安装和配置这些组件将帮助你搭建一个稳定、高效的微信资源服务器。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建微信资源服务器是为了方便用户上传和下载文件,以及支持微信小程序和公众号的相关功能。以下是关于如何搭建微信资源服务器的步骤:

    1. 购买服务器:首先需要购买一个能够承载微信资源服务器的物理服务器或者云服务器。根据预计的用户量和流量,选择合适的服务器规格和带宽。

    2. 安装操作系统:根据服务器的硬件要求,安装相应的操作系统。常见的选择包括Linux、Windows Server等。

    3. 配置网络:根据服务器提供商的指引,对服务器进行网络配置,分配IP地址和域名。

    4. 安装Web服务器:微信资源服务器一般使用Nginx或Apache等Web服务器软件。根据操作系统的不同,选择对应的安装方式,将Web服务器安装在服务器上。

    5. 配置SSL证书:为了保证数据的安全性,需要为服务器配置SSL证书。可以向证书颁发机构购买证书,或者使用免费的Let's Encrypt证书。

    6. 安装数据库:微信资源服务器一般需要使用数据库存储用户信息和文件信息。常见的选择包括MySQL、PostgreSQL等。根据操作系统的不同,选择对应的安装方式,将数据库安装在服务器上。

    7. 配置文件存储路径:微信资源服务器需要将用户上传的文件存储在服务器上。在Web服务器的配置文件中,指定文件存储的路径。可以选择创建一个独立的文件夹用于存储微信资源。

    8. 配置反向代理:为了提高服务器的性能和安全性,可以配置反向代理。将请求转发给不同的服务器实例,分担服务器的负载。常见的反向代理软件有Nginx、HAProxy等。

    9. 配置防火墙和安全性:为了保护服务器免受攻击,可以配置防火墙和其他安全性措施。限制服务器的入口、出口流量,禁止不必要的服务和端口。

    10. 测试和调试:完成上述步骤后,进行测试和调试。确保服务器能够正常运行,上传和下载文件的功能正常。

    总结起来,搭建微信资源服务器需要购买服务器、安装操作系统和Web服务器、配置SSL证书、安装数据库、配置文件存储路径、配置反向代理、配置防火墙和安全性,最后进行测试和调试。根据实际情况,还可以通过负载均衡、缓存系统等进一步优化服务器性能。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    微信资源服务器的搭建涉及服务器的配置、网络环境的设置和动态请求的处理等多个步骤。下面,我将介绍如何搭建一个微信资源服务器。

    1. 选择服务器
      首先,选择适合的服务器来搭建微信资源服务器。可以选择使用云服务器、虚拟主机或自己搭建的物理服务器等。确保服务器具备足够的硬件资源和网络带宽,以支持资源服务器的正常运行。

    2. 安装操作系统
      根据服务器的选择,安装相应的操作系统。常见的操作系统有Windows Server、Linux等。对于新手来说,建议使用Linux操作系统,如Ubuntu。Linux操作系统具备稳定性高、安全性好等优点,适合用来搭建服务器。

    3. 安装必要的软件
      搭建微信资源服务器需要安装一些必要的软件,如Web服务器、数据库等。常用的Web服务器有Apache和Nginx,常用的数据库有MySQL和MongoDB。根据实际需求选择合适的软件进行安装。

    4. 配置网络环境
      在搭建微信资源服务器前,需要配置好服务器的网络环境。首先,为服务器配置一个固定的IP地址,以便于微信公众号服务器能够访问资源服务器。其次,需要进行端口映射,将服务器内部的某个端口映射到外网上的一个端口,以便于公众号能够访问到资源服务器。

    5. 编写代码
      在服务器上编写代码,处理动态请求和静态文件的访问。根据实际需求,可以选择不同的编程语言和框架来编写代码。例如,可以使用Python的Flask框架来处理请求和响应,并使用SQLAlchemy来操作数据库。

    6. 配置服务器
      根据服务器的软件和应用需求,对服务器进行相应的配置。例如,对于Web服务器,需要配置虚拟主机、HTTPS等。对于数据库,需要设置用户权限、数据库安全等。

    7. 测试服务器
      在上线之前,需要对服务器进行测试,以确保其正常运行。可以测试服务器是否能够正确响应请求,并确保数据库的读写操作正常。

    8. 部署服务器
      在服务器测试通过后,可以将其部署在线上环境中,供微信公众号访问和使用。确保服务器稳定运行,并定期进行维护和更新。

    总结:
    搭建微信资源服务器需要进行服务器的选择、操作系统的安装、必要软件的安装、网络环境的配置、代码的编写和服务器的配置等多个步骤。通过以上步骤,可以搭建一个稳定、安全、高效的微信资源服务器,以满足微信公众号的资源需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部